Creamy Polenta with Garlic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
1 tablespoon minced fresh garlic
3½ cups reduced-sodium chicken broth, divided
1 cup yellow cornmeal
2 ounces ⅓ less fat cream cheese (Neufchatel)

Directions:
Directions:
Spray large saucepan with cooking spray.
Add garlic; cook over medium-high heat 1 to 2 minutes or until golden brown, stirring frequently.
Add 2½ cups broth; bring to a boil.

Combine remaining 1 cup broth and cornmeal.
Gradually add to broth in saucepan, stirring constantly with wire whisk until well blended.

Cook over low heat 5 minutes or until thickened, stirring constantly.
Add cream cheese; cook and stir until cream cheese is melted completely and mixture is well blended.
